You have an RTX 4050 along with Intel Integrated graphics. Your Studio Runtime Info says that the GPU that’s being used for Studio is the integrated one. You should try to use the Nvidia Control Panel to forcefully open Roblox with your dedicated graphics card rather than your integrated one and see if the problem persists.

There’s some good advice in this thread on updating drivers - generally when you see a lockout like this its at the HW/kernel/driver level. Studio hanging will hang the process, not the OS. Because of the nature of the issue we may not get anything but the next time it occurs please up load the latest log after restarting.

Also, what’s the frequency of “sometimes” - is there anything specific you can recall happening before the freeze? Has the place opened? Are you on the starting page? If Studio does open correctly, does it freeze sometime later, or is it something where once its open it works fine?
